As well as a lot of new songs, the new year has brought a change of line-up: Richard Murison has left, on very good terms, to focus on his music therapy work, and Tamora has taken over the role of bass-player, bringing her own particular quiet wild energy to the band...
Tundra intend to reconvene the octet (chamber) line up for the May gig, but in the meantime the trio of Tom, Tamora and Suzanne are exploring the pared down sound, which is bringing the feel rather than the gesture, the songwriting rather than the texture, to the forefront of the band's aesthetic.
